Engine Speed Sensor: Testing and Inspection
Engine Speed (RPM) Sensor -G28-, Checking
Recommended special tools and equipment
- V.A.G 1526A multimeter
- V.A.G 1594A connector test kit
- V.A.G 1598/31 test box
NOTE: The engine speed (RPM) sensor -G28- detects RPM and reference marks. The engine cannot be started without a signal from the engine speed (RPM) sensor -G28-. If the engine speed (RPM) sensor -G28- signal fails while the engine is running, the engine will stop immediately.
Test requirement:
- Ignition switched off.
Procedure
- Before performing test, check sensor for proper installation and proper fitting.
- Remove coolant reservoir -2- -arrows-
- Disconnect electrical wire from Engine Coolant Level (ECL) Warning Switch -F66- and set aside coolant reservoir with coolant hoses -1- and -3- connected.
- Disconnect electrical harness connector -2- from Engine Speed (RPM) Sensor -G28-.
Checking internal resistance
- Connect multimeter between terminal 2 and 3 for resistance measurement.
- Specified value: 450 to 1000 ohm
NOTE: Resistance value of the engine speed (RPM) sensor is based on a temperature of 20 degrees C. Resistance increases as temperature increases.
If specified value is not obtained:
- Replace Engine Speed (RPM) sensor.
If specified value is obtained:
- Connect multimeter to terminals 2 and 1 (shielding) as well as to terminals 3 and 1 (shielding) for resistance measurement.
- Specified value: each Infinite Ohms (no continuity)
If specified value is not obtained:
- Replace Engine Speed (RPM) sensor.
If specified value is obtained:
Checking wire connections
- Connect test box to wiring harness of Engine Control Module (ECM), ECM is not connected. Test Box, Connecting For Wiring and Component Test
- Check the following wire connections for open circuit according to wiring diagram:
Harness connector Terminal Test box Socket
1 (shielding) 108
2 Ground (GND) 90
3 (signal) 82
Specified value: Wire resistance max 1.5 Ohms
- Check wires for short circuit to each other as well as to B+ and Ground (GND).
- Specified value: Infinite Ohms (no continuity)
- If necessary, repair wire connection.
If no malfunctions are detected:
- Replace Engine Control Module (ECM).

Final procedures
After repair work, the following work steps must be performed in the mentioned sequence:
1. Check DTC memory see "Mode 3: Check DTC memory". Mode 3: Check DTC Memory
2. If necessary, erase DTC memory see "Mode 4: Reset/erase diagnostic data". Mode 4: Reset/Erase Diagnostic Data
3. Generate readiness code. Readiness Code, Generating
- End diagnosis and switch ignition off.
